Dr. William Beardslee is Director of the Baer Prevention Initiatives and Chairman Emeritus of the Department of Psychiatry at Boston Children’s Hospital, as well as the George P. Gardner and Olga E. Monks Distinguished Professor of Psychiatry at Harvard Medical School.
